Man out of the U.S arrested in connection with Taber bomb threats
Taber, AB – The Taber Police Service has announced a man from Illinois, USA has been arrested following multiple bomb threats to different Taber community locations over the past 48 hours.
The arrest was made on 10 counts of felony bomb threats.
Westlake Elementary School and WR Myers School both received anonymous threats by voicemail Friday morning.
Also on Friday via Twitter, the Horizon School Division confirmed Central Elementary School received a similar threat in the afternoon. Students had been dismissed and were out of the building at the time the threat was reported. Police investigated and determined it was a hoax.
